Hall-D Software  alpha
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Groups Pages
JEventProcessor_TAGM_TW.cc File Reference
#include "JEventProcessor_TAGM_TW.h"
#include <JANA/JApplication.h>
#include <JANA/JFactory.h>
#include <TH1.h>
#include <TH2.h>
#include <TDirectory.h>
#include "TAGGER/DTAGMHit.h"
#include "RF/DRFTime_factory.h"

Go to the source code of this file.

Functions

void InitPlugin (JApplication *app)
 

Variables

const uint32_t NCOLUMNS = 102
 
const uint32_t NSINGLES = 20
 
const uint32_t NROWS = 5
 
const int32_t PMIN = 0
 
const int32_t PMAX = 2000
 
const int32_t PBIN = (PMAX - PMIN)/16
 
const int32_t TMIN = -50
 
const int32_t TMAX = 50
 
const int32_t TBIN = (TMAX - TMIN)/0.05
 
const double TMIN_RF = -2.0
 
const double TMAX_RF = 2.0
 
const double TBIN_RF = (TMAX_RF - TMIN_RF)/0.05
 
const double TMIN_TW = -10.0
 
const double TMAX_TW = 15.0
 
const double TBIN_TW = (TMAX_TW - TMIN_TW)/0.05
 
static TH2I * h_dt_vs_pp [NCOLUMNS]
 
static TH2I * h_dt_vs_pp_tdc [NCOLUMNS]
 
static TH2I * h_dt_vs_pp_ind [NROWS][4]
 
static TH2I * h_dt_vs_pp_tdc_ind [NROWS][4]
 
static TH2I * h_tdc_adc_all
 
static TH2I * h_tdc_adc_all_ind
 
static TH2I * h_t_adc_all
 
static TH2I * h_t_adc_all_ind
 
static TH2I * h_adc_rf_all
 
static TH2I * h_adc_rf_all_ind
 
DRFTime_factorydRFTimeFactory
 

Function Documentation

void InitPlugin ( JApplication *  app)

Definition at line 58 of file JEventProcessor_TAGM_TW.cc.

Variable Documentation

TH2I* h_adc_rf_all
static
TH2I* h_adc_rf_all_ind
static
TH2I* h_dt_vs_pp[NCOLUMNS]
static

Definition at line 41 of file JEventProcessor_TAGM_TW.cc.

TH2I* h_dt_vs_pp_ind[NROWS][4]
static
TH2I* h_dt_vs_pp_tdc[NCOLUMNS]
static
TH2I* h_dt_vs_pp_tdc_ind[NROWS][4]
static
TH2I* h_t_adc_all
static
TH2I* h_t_adc_all_ind
static
TH2I* h_tdc_adc_all
static
TH2I* h_tdc_adc_all_ind
static
const uint32_t NROWS = 5

Definition at line 21 of file JEventProcessor_TAGM_TW.cc.

Referenced by JEventProcessor_TAGM_TW::init().

const int32_t PBIN = (PMAX - PMIN)/16

Definition at line 25 of file JEventProcessor_TAGM_TW.cc.

Referenced by JEventProcessor_TAGM_TW::init().

const int32_t PMAX = 2000

Definition at line 24 of file JEventProcessor_TAGM_TW.cc.

const int32_t PMIN = 0

Definition at line 23 of file JEventProcessor_TAGM_TW.cc.

const int32_t TBIN = (TMAX - TMIN)/0.05

Definition at line 29 of file JEventProcessor_TAGM_TW.cc.

Referenced by JEventProcessor_TAGM_TW::init().

const double TBIN_RF = (TMAX_RF - TMIN_RF)/0.05

Definition at line 33 of file JEventProcessor_TAGM_TW.cc.

Referenced by JEventProcessor_TAGM_TW::init().

const double TBIN_TW = (TMAX_TW - TMIN_TW)/0.05

Definition at line 37 of file JEventProcessor_TAGM_TW.cc.

Referenced by JEventProcessor_TAGM_TW::init().

const int32_t TMAX = 50

Definition at line 28 of file JEventProcessor_TAGM_TW.cc.

const double TMAX_RF = 2.0

Definition at line 32 of file JEventProcessor_TAGM_TW.cc.

Referenced by JEventProcessor_TAGM_TW::init().

const double TMAX_TW = 15.0

Definition at line 36 of file JEventProcessor_TAGM_TW.cc.

Referenced by JEventProcessor_TAGM_TW::init().

const int32_t TMIN = -50

Definition at line 27 of file JEventProcessor_TAGM_TW.cc.

const double TMIN_RF = -2.0

Definition at line 31 of file JEventProcessor_TAGM_TW.cc.

Referenced by JEventProcessor_TAGM_TW::init().

const double TMIN_TW = -10.0

Definition at line 35 of file JEventProcessor_TAGM_TW.cc.

Referenced by JEventProcessor_TAGM_TW::init().